POTENSI TANAMAN MAKROHIDROFITA DAN SEMIHIDROFITA UNTUK REMEDIASI LIMBAH CAIR PABRIK TAPIOKA

Eko Rini Indriyatie

Abstract

Potensial role of a macrohydrophyte plant (Veyivera zizanioides) and four semihydrophyte plants (Ipomoea aquatica, Cyperus iria, Commelina nudiflora, Oryza sativa) as remediators of liquid waste of tapioca industry was tested in a glasshouse for 35 days under conditions that resemble to wet and polyculture systems. Results dhowed that all type of plants grew normally on media containing tapioca liquid waste. Total biomass of Ipomoea aquatica and polyculture grown in wet conditions were 32,35 g and 38,44 g, respectively. This were higher than those of control (30,53 g and 36,39 g). Those of V. zizanioides, Cyperus iria, Commelina nudiflora and Oryza sativa were inversely observed. Hawever, V. zizanioides showed the highest tollerance index value (120,99%) compared to that of Ipomoea aquatica (91,21 %), Cyperus iria (56,62 %), Commelina nudiflora (89,63 %), Oryza sativa (83,13 %), and polyculture (62,25 %)
